Diego Maradona briefly
During Maradona's first spell in Argentina, the Championship was played in two stages,
the league stage (Metropolitano Championship) and knockout stage (Nacional
Championship). Maradona was banned in 1991 after testing positive for Cocaine while
playing for Napoli. When he returned to play in Argentina the Championship was
played over two league stages. He was banned a second time after testing positive
for performance enhancing drugs during the 1994 World Cup.
Maradona at his best
Born in 1960 in Villa Fiorito, Argentina, Diego Armando Maradona went on to almost single-handedly lead his country to one World Cup Final victory in 1986 and then back to the Final four years later where they were beaten by West Germany. As well as leading unfashionable Napoli to two Italian League titles and breaking the world record transfer fee when he joined Barcelona in 1982, Maradona went on to become regarded as perhaps the greatest footballer who ever played the game.
Maradona 'the hand of god'
Speaking on his TV show, Maradona said the intervention, which he nicknamed "The Hand of God", was justified. "The truth is that I don't for a second regret scoring that goal with my hand," he said on the programme. The footballer apparently defended his goal as his response to Britain's claim to the Falkland islands. He said he wanted to let Argentines and the whole world know the truth about a key moment in football history. Maradona scored the goal by punching the ball into the net during a jump as goalkeeper Peter Shilton leapt into the air towards the ball.
More Interesting things about Maradona
In his 20-year career before retiring in 1997, Maradona starred at Argentinos Juniors and Boca Juniors and in Europe. He also led Argentina to the 1990 World Cup final and won Italian and Argentine league titles. In 2000, FIFA chose him and Pele as the best players in soccer history.Maradona's career, however, was filled with negatives as well as positives. In 1991, he failed a drug test and was banned for 15 months.
